# engine.solver.ResponsibleEngineeringModel { #mlsysim.engine.solver.ResponsibleEngineeringModel }
```python
engine.solver.ResponsibleEngineeringModel()
```
Models the computational cost of responsible AI practices (Wall 20: Safety).
This model quantifies the 'Safety Tax' — the additional compute and data
required for differential privacy or fairness guarantees.
Literature Source:
1. Abadi et al. (2016), "Deep Learning with Differential Privacy."
2. Anil et al. (2022), "Large-Scale Differentially Private BERT."
